diff --git a/bricks/form.js b/bricks/form.js index 2864c29..86e8021 100644 --- a/bricks/form.js +++ b/bricks/form.js @@ -244,10 +244,10 @@ bricks.FormBase = class extends bricks.Layout { w.focus(); return; } - if (name != 'id' && d[name] === null){ + if (d[name] === null){ continue; } - if (this.origin_data[name] == d[name]){ + if (name != 'id' && this.origin_data[name] == d[name]){ continue; } w.set_formdata(data);